Description
Metallurgical Microscope YR0251 – YR0252 is an advanced optical device designed for professionals in the metallurgical and materials science fields. Featuring a Seidentopf trinocular head inclined at 30° with an interpupillary range of 48-75mm, this microscope offers a versatile viewing experience. Equipped with extra wide field eyepieces (EW10x/22mm) and an Infinity Optical System, it allows precise observation of specimens in both bright field and dark field settings, as well as polarizing functions. With features such as a coaxial coarse and fine adjustment knob, swing condenser, and external illumination with a halogen lamp (6V30W), the YR0251 – YR0252 model sets a new standard for accuracy and efficiency in microscopic examination.

Frequently Asked Questions
Q1: What is the benefit of having a trinocular head?
A1: The trinocular head allows users to attach a camera for capture and analysis while viewing the specimen, making it ideal for documentation and teaching.
Q2: What are the main applications of this microscope?
A2: This microscope is primarily used for metallurgical analysis, including examining the microstructure of metals, alloys, and other industrial materials.

Use in the Field
In practical settings, the Metallurgical Microscope YR0251 – YR0252 is utilized by material scientists and metallurgists to conduct thorough examinations of metal samples. Its precision optics and adaptable illumination systems allow users to detect even the most minute structural details, which are crucial for quality control and research development.
